Pokhara is where you begin the experience. Nepal's most romantic urban center is located on the shore of Phewa Lake, with the Annapurna mountain range being reflected in the water on clear mornings. You will discover coffee shops around the lake, get up very early to row the boat, make the hilltop Peace Pagoda your target, and, most importantly, rest in a place that is much slower and softer than Kathmandu.
Nagarkot raises the bar for the entire trip. Situated on the top of a hill to the east of Kathmandu at about 2,175 meters, Nagarkot has been the place of choice for many tourists and locals for its breathtaking view of the Himalayas.
When the sky is clear, one can see the line of mountain peaks ranging from Dhaulagiri in the west to Kanchenjunga in the east. Experiencing the sunrise casting its colors on the mountains while in your room is indeed the kind of memory that a couple cherishes forever.
